This annoyed me as well. Bought some VVidid matte vinyl on Amazon. Made a template, cut the vinyl to fit and it seems to be holding up after a month. Pics below.

I noticed this immediately upon driving my R1T for the first time and it was a surpise because I've never had this issue on past vehicles. The mirror posts have flat mirror black surfaces. All my other vehicles have posts that are round and/or not smooth. In any case, my brain seems to be tuning out the reflections for the most part now.

Hi all,
So after 1449 days, I finally got my R1S, and I'm a happy camper (despite having to do a full reset at the SC before driving away!) But here's my pet peeve, which I'm posting just for the lols, as I don't think I've seen it described before. The driver's mirror mount is too shiny, and any time I get reflections from buildings, trees or the like, I get a momentary feeling that someone's overtaking me. Is anyone else distracted by these reflections, or is it just me? (I think I already know the answer..... :) )
